Cellulose Pulp Machinery Imports

Imports into Algeria

In 2022, purchases abroad of machinery for making pulp of fibrous cellulosic material decreased by -20% to X units for the first time since 2018, thus ending a three-year rising trend. Over the period under review, imports saw a abrupt setback.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2020 when imports increased by 200%. Imports peaked at X units in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2022, imports remained at a lower figure.

In value terms, cellulose pulp machinery imports contracted markedly to $X in 2022. Overall, imports recorded a abrupt decrease.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2020 when imports increased by 272%. Imports peaked at $X in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2022, imports failed to regain momentum.

Imports by Country

In 2022, China (X units) was the main cellulose pulp machinery supplier to Algeria, accounting for a approx. 100% share of total imports.

From 2012 to 2022, the average annual growth rate of volume from China amounted to -2.2%.

In value terms, China ($X) constituted the largest supplier of machinery for making pulp of fibrous cellulosic material to Algeria, comprising 60%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by France ($X), with a 6.1% share of total imports.

From 2012 to 2022, the average annual growth rate of value from China amounted to -8.0%.

The countries with the highest volumes of in 2021 were China, Brazil and Russia, with a combined 48% share of global consumption. These countries were followed by Sweden, Austria, Estonia, Finland, Serbia, Costa Rica and Indonesia, which together accounted for a further 34%.
China remains the largest cellulose pulp machinery producing country worldwide, accounting for 33% of total volume. Moreover, cellulose pulp machinery production in China ex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est producer, Sweden, twofold. Austria ranked third in terms of total production with a 14% share.
